If I'm washing my truck at my house I always just fill up my 2 buckets with warm/hot water from inside, and I am totally fine! Give it a try, warm water + jacket = washing all winter.

Now if I go to someone else's house to wash their car, I just wear rubber gloves and mitts underneath to keep my hand warmish/dry.
